WASHINGTON - Walmart (WMT) has pulled a T-shirt offered by an outside seller from its online store after a journalist advocacy group told the retailer it found the shirt threatening. The shirt, listed on Walmart.com through third-party seller Teespring, said: "Rope. Tree. Journalist. SOME ASSEMBLY REQUIRED." "This item was sold by a third-party seller on our marketplace and clearly violates our policy," Walmart said. "We removed it as soon as it was brought to our attention, and are conducting a thorough review of the seller's assortment."

A Georgia family is under fire for allowing a seventh grader to wear a T-shirt that mocked liberal news network CNN on a school field trip to CNN’s Atlanta headquarters -- but the boy's parents think the school violated the First Amendment by making their son take it off. Nancy and Stan Jester, of Dekalb, are both local elected officials, she a county commissioner and he is a member of the local school board. Their son, seventh-grader Jaxon, wore a shirt mocking the CNN logo as “FNN” with the caption, “Fake News Network.”

A US clothing company has come under fire after T-shirts appeared online featuring swastikas in a move aimed at reclaiming the symbol as one of "love". The attempt to rebrand the Nazi emblem as a symbol of "peace" was criticised on social media as the public refused to support the campaign. Days after the design appeared, it was replaced with an "anti-swastika" print. The swastika is an ancient symbol said to have represented good fortune in almost every culture in the world. Former Democratic Party presidential nominee Hillary Clinton tweeted a message to her followers on Tuesday telling them to purchase a "Nasty Woman" t-shirt to help support Planned Parenthood and late-night television host Samantha Bee. During the third presidential debate in 2016, then-candidate Donald Trump called Clinton a "nasty woman" when she insinuated that Trump does not pay taxes. A few months later, it would appear that Clinton has embraced the term "nasty woman." The former first lady tweeted out a photo of herself holding up a "Nasty Woman" t-shirt, with a caption calling on her followers to buy one.

The yearbook advisor at a central New Jersey high school had been suspended after the President Trump logo on students’ clothing vanished from their final photo. Grant Berardo, 17, says that he was shocked to find his “Trump: Make America Great Again” shirt had lost its political message in Wall High School’s “Behind the Scenes” book for 2016-2017. Wall Township School Superintendent Cheryl Dyer said that the district is investigating why that image, and Trump’s name on another student’s sweater vest, were wiped out. A high school student was threatened with suspension from her classes after wearing a T-shirt declaring Hillary for Prison 2016. Maxine Yeakle, who is voting for Donald Trump, said she was pulled out of class at Boca Raton High School in Florida because of what she was wearing. The 18-year-old posted a video on Facebook on Tuesday, saying the school’s assistant principal had admitted there were no rules against clothes with political slogans on them, but said she faced in-school suspension (ISS) because of the disruption it was causing. …

Two men, clad in T-shirts proclaiming their support for Donald Trump, were booted from a Mission District beer garden during the summer. The pair, identified by SFist as Peter Belau and Jascha Sundaresan, said they were violently ejected from Zeitgeist because of their political choice. However, Zeitgeist’s General Manager Gideon Bush accused them of making sexist remarks and “interacting inappropriately with one of our bartenders,” according to Hoodline.
